Hi, Saturday, December 28, 2002, 9:00:15 PM, you wrote: I have a question for the other Manfrotto 055 users. I have problems with the leg locks on mine. They are a lever style of lock, and I can either get the lock loose enough to allow the legs to slide when in the relaxed position, or tight enough to support a camera in the locked position, but not both. Does anyone have amy hints for adjusting the levers so that the darned tripod will work? there's a little device on the springs which lets you adjust the tension.
